Erosion control. <br />Purpose <br />The putpose of this chapter is to protect sutface water quahty and safeguard private <br />ropertty and public welfare by establishing etosion control. <br /> <br />N. Scope <br />This chapter sets forth rules and regulations to related to erosion control; establishes <br />the administrative procedute for review of plans and inspection of Etosion Control <br />practices <br /> <br />Best management practices as defined by the MPCA, requitements of the NPDES <br />Construction permit shall apply in the subdivision and development of land areas <br />including construction sites permitted thtough grading permits or building permits. <br /> <br />O. Storm Water Pollution Prevention Plan (SWPPP) <br /> <br />1. A Storm Water Pollution Prevention Plan (SWPPP) is requited for all <br />construction sites with a distutbed area greater than or equal to twenty <br />thousand (20,000) square feet. The SWPPP must be submitted for review <br />and apptoved prior to any land distutbing activities. The SWPPP will <br />desiguate the temporary and permanent etosion control measutes to be <br />incorporated in the site development. The SWPPP must meet the <br />requitements described in the MPCA NPDES construction permit, PART <br />III as well as the requited contents and format of the SWPPP <br />described in the City of Elk River Engineering Desigu Guidelines. <br /> <br />2. Sites with less than twenty thousand (20,000) square feet of distutbed area <br />are requited to meet the ptovisions of the MPCA NPDES construction site <br />permit PART IV related to etosion and sediment conttol. This requitement <br />applies to consttuction sites permitted by a building and or grading permit <br />issued by the City of Elk River. <br /> <br />3. Consttuction sites must have perimeter best management practices and <br />consttuction site enttances installed and inspected before the City of Elk <br />River will issue a permit for building. <br /> <br />4.
